Many Primary 4 students in Singapore struggle with accurately reading the minutes on an analog clock. This often stems from not fully understanding that each number on the clock face represents five-minute intervals, not just the number itself. Instead of seeing the '3' as 15 minutes past the hour, some kids might mistakenly read it as just '3 minutes'. This misunderstanding significantly impacts their ability to correctly tell time and calculate elapsed time, which are crucial skills to excel in Singapore Primary 4 Math. The overlapping of the hour and minute hands can be a real source of confusion. When the minute hand is nearing the '12', the hour hand also moves closer to the next hour. This makes it difficult for some children to clearly distinguish which hour the time is referring to. For example, at 5:55, the hour hand is almost at the '6', and this can lead to the child incorrectly stating the time as 6:55. Practicing with clocks that have distinctly colored hands can help mitigate this issue, as can using real-life scenarios like “almost time for dinner!”
A common error arises when students need to determine the minutes *to* the hour, rather than the minutes *past* the hour. Instead of counting forward from the '12', they need to count backward. For example, if the minute hand is on the '9', many struggle to understand that it’s 15 minutes *to* the next hour (or 45 minutes past the hour). Using a number line to visualise the minutes in both directions, forward and backward from the '12', is a very helpful learning tool. Here's the thing: elapsed time problems often involve more than just simple subtraction. It's not just 2:00 PM minus 1:00 PM. Here's where students often go wrong:
* **Forgetting to Account for AM/PM:** A classic! They might subtract the numbers correctly but fail to realize that 8:00 AM to 6:00 PM is *not* just 2 hours. * **Borrowing Difficulties with Minutes:** When subtracting minutes, students sometimes forget that there are 60 minutes in an hour, not 100. This leads to all sorts of funky calculations. * **Not Visualizing the Time:** They try to do everything in their head, which can get confusing, especially with longer time intervals.

They provide a visual representation of the problem, making it much easier to understand and solve. Here's how to use them:
1. **Draw a Straight Line:** Keep it simple. 2. **Mark the Start and End Times:** Clearly label the beginning and ending points of the time interval. 3. **Break it Down into Manageable Chunks:** Instead of trying to calculate the entire duration at once, break it down into smaller, easier-to-calculate segments. For example, if you're calculating the time from 10:15 AM to 1:45 PM, you could break it down like this: * 10:15 AM to 11:00 AM (45 minutes) * 11:00 AM to 1:00 PM (2 hours) * 1:00 PM to 1:45 PM (45 minutes) 4. **Add Up the Time Segments:** Once you've calculated the duration of each segment, simply add them together to find the total elapsed time. In our example, 45 minutes + 2 hours + 45 minutes = 3 hours and 30 minutes.

Let's make this relatable, *lah*! Imagine your child needs to calculate the travel time between two locations in Singapore. This is a perfect opportunity to apply the timeline method.
**Example:**
A train leaves Jurong East MRT station at 8:35 AM and arrives at Changi Airport MRT station at 9:52 AM. How long is the train journey?

1. **Draw a Timeline:** Mark 8:35 AM as the start time and 9:52 AM as the end time. 2. **Break it Down:** * 8:35 AM to 9:00 AM (25 minutes) * 9:00 AM to 9:52 AM (52 minutes) 3. **Add it Up:** 25 minutes + 52 minutes = 77 minutes, or 1 hour and 17 minutes.
See? Not so scary, right? By using timelines and breaking down the problem into smaller steps, your child can confidently tackle even the trickiest elapsed time questions. Students sometimes misread the hour and minute hands on an analog clock. They might mistake the hour hand for the minute hand, especially when the hour hand is approaching the next number. Regular practice with varied clock positions and clear explanations can help improve accuracy.
When solving elapsed time problems, students may forget to include the units (hours, minutes) in their final answer. This oversight can lead to incorrect solutions and a lack of understanding of the time duration. Always remind students to label their answers with the appropriate unit of measurement.
A common mistake is mixing up AM and PM, especially when calculating elapsed time. Students might incorrectly assume that 8:00 AM plus 5 hours is 1:00 AM instead of 1:00 PM. Emphasize real-world scenarios and activities that occur during different times of the day to reinforce understanding.
